Я пишу сообщение в блоге о ранних API для мобильных веб-сайтов, и Алекс Рассел напомнил мне о Google Gears
Gears modules include:
- LocalServer Cache and serve application resources (HTML, JavaScript, images, etc.) locally
- Database Store data locally in a fully-searchable relational database
- WorkerPool Make your web applications more responsive by performing resource-intensive operations asynchronously
Я думаю, что интересно видеть, что AppCache и WebSQL, Geolocation и WebWorkers вышли из идей в Google Gears, и только последние два из них действительно выжили. WebSQL никогда не поддерживался широко, и его заменил IndexedDB; и AppCache заменен ServiceWorker